On-camera talent runs in the family at the Ennis household, with former NRL star and Fox League commentator Michael Ennis gearing up for his daughter Kobyfox’s Nickelodeon debut.
The 11-year-old dancer is twirling in her father’s footsteps as she prepares to star on season two of READY SET DANCE and she told Confidential that his advice has helped her camera presence.
“Sometimes I get butterflies in my stomach because I’m worried that something is going to mess up but I’ve learned from dad that it’s ok to mess up and that you learn from those mistakes,” she said.
Former Cronulla premiership winner Ennis said the advice he gives his daughter is simple.

“The biggest thing that I’ve sort of learned after doing it for the last four years now at Fox Sports, the best advice I can give her is to just be yourself,” he said.
“Be authentic, have fun. I don’t think anyone can ever question you when you’re being yourself. She’s a really vibrant young girl, and loves to have fun and I tell her to show that, be confident and just be yourself.”
KobyFox began dancing at age two and specialises in contemporary, lyrical, ballet and hiphop.
Nickelodeon’s new season of READY SET DANCE is a participatory dance show designed to get preschoolers moving at home and it premieres on May 11 at 8.30am on Foxtel’s Nick Jr. (channel 703).
